Comment:

 Given the implementation of multiple template engines that landed in
 Django 1.8, Django template loaders aren't the right point to fix this
 problem anymore. For this reason I'm closing the ticket.

 Unfortunately internationalization didn't make it in Django 1.8. Further
 work is tracked in 24167#.
